Plot Summary: A Murder on the Riviera
The glamorous Katherine Grey receives an unexpected inheritance. She embarks on a luxurious trip aboard the Blue Train, a famous express traveling to the French Riviera. Onboard, she encounters Ruth Kettering, a rich American heiress trapped in an unhappy marriage. Ruth is carrying the legendary “Heart of Fire” ruby, a rare jewel that many would kill for.
The next morning, Ruth is found brutally murdered in her compartment, and the priceless ruby is missing. The case seems impossible to solve—until Hercule Poirot, the brilliant Belgian detective, steps in. As Poirot investigates, he uncovers hidden identities, false alibis, and shocking betrayals. But can he find the killer before they strike again?
